About S. H. Eik‐Nes

S. H. Eik‐Nes is a scholar working on Obstetrics and Gynecology, Pediatrics, Perinatology and Child Health, Developmental Biology, Urology and Surgery, having authored 34 papers that have together received 1.3k indexed citations. Recurring topics across this work include Prenatal Screening and Diagnostics (11 papers), Pregnancy and preeclampsia studies (9 papers), Fetal and Pediatric Neurological Disorders (7 papers), Congenital Anomalies and Fetal Surgery (6 papers), Birth, Development, and Health (5 papers), Congenital Diaphragmatic Hernia Studies (5 papers), Assisted Reproductive Technology and Twin Pregnancy (4 papers) and Neonatal Respiratory Health Research (3 papers). The work is most often cited by research in Obstetrics and Gynecology (498 citations), Pediatrics, Perinatology and Child Health (706 citations), Reproductive Medicine (166 citations), Urology (76 citations) and Surgery (303 citations). S. H. Eik‐Nes has collaborated with scholars based in Norway, Finland and Sweden. Frequent co-authors include H.‐G. K. Blaas, Torvid Kiserud, Leif Rune Hellevik, P. Grøttum, Solveig Tingulstad, Bjørn Hagen, L. Valentin, Bjarne C. Eriksen, A. Brantberg and K. Å. Salvesen. Their work appears in journals such as Ultrasound in Obstetrics and Gynecology, BJOG An International Journal of Obstetrics & Gynaecology, Prenatal Diagnosis, Haematologica and Obstetrical & Gynecological Survey.
